As we ​navigate through 2024, the mineral markets ⁤are experiencing unprecedented volatility, influenced by a confluence of factors including geopolitical tensions, fluctuating⁢ demand, and supply chain disruptions. This ​article aims to dissect the underlying drivers of this volatility, examining​ the impacts of global economic conditions, regulatory changes,⁣ and technological advancements on mineral prices and availability. By understanding these dynamics, industry stakeholders can better strategize and adapt to​ the ⁣rapidly shifting ⁣landscape of the mineral sector.

The mineral market in 2024 is influenced by‍ a‍ range‌ of economic indicators ⁤that investors must closely monitor. ⁤Key factors include global ‌supply chain ‌dynamics, demand trends ⁣from emerging ⁣markets, and geopolitical tensions. Economic indicators such as GDP growth rates, inflation rates, and interest rates play ​a⁤ significant role in shaping investor sentiment and,⁤ consequently, mineral prices. In particular, the following aspects are critical for understanding price⁤ movements:

  • Supply and Demand Balance: Fluctuations in production and consumption patterns directly affect availability and pricing.
  • Geopolitical ⁢Risks: Conflicts ⁤or changes in trade policies can disrupt supply chains, leading to volatility.
  • Technological Advancements: Innovations in extraction and processing techniques can lower costs ​and impact market competitiveness.

Strategically, investors should consider diversifying their portfolios to mitigate risks associated with market volatility. Allocating resources to a⁢ mix of ‍commodities and geographic regions⁣ can buffer against localized shocks. Regularly assessing market ⁢trends and employing technical analysis can also ⁣aid in making informed ​investment decisions. Furthermore, understanding the long-term implications of emerging trends—such as the shift towards sustainable practices⁤ and the demand for ⁤green ​technologies—will be essential for positioning investments for future growth. A focused look at the projected impacts of electric vehicle adoption‌ and renewable energy developments ‌will help inform strategic choices.
